Understanding Tokenized Invoice in Web3
In the rapidly evolving world of blockchain and cryptocurrency, the concept of tokenized invoice centers around the use of digital tokens to represent invoices on the blockchain. This innovation is part of the broader trends in Web3 infrastructure that seeks to augment transparency, efficiency, and security in transactions.
What is a Tokenized Invoice?
A tokenized invoice is a digital representation of an invoice that has been converted into a token and stored on the blockchain. Each invoice is uniquely identified by a specific token that carries metadata such as the payment amount, due date, and related transaction details.
Benefits of Tokenized Invoices
- Transparency: All participants in the transaction can view the invoice on the blockchain, ensuring everyone agrees on the terms.
- Security: The use of blockchain technology means invoices are protected against tampering and fraud.
- Automation: Smart contracts can automate the payment process once certain conditions are met, enhancing operational efficiency.
- Traceability: Every transaction related to the invoice can be tracked and verified, simplifying audits and compliance.
How Tokenized Invoices Work
The process begins when a business generates an invoice. This invoice is then tokenized, creating a digital token that encapsulates all relevant information. This token is registered on a blockchain which allows it to be transferred between parties, traded, or used as collateral, similar to how other digital assets are managed.
Components of a Tokenized Invoice
A typical tokenized invoice contains:
- Invoice ID: A unique identifier for tracking purposes.
- Amount: The total payable amount detailed in the invoice.
- Due Date: The deadline for payment, making it clear when the transaction is expected to be completed.
- Token Address: A designated address on the blockchain where the token is stored.
- Status: Information regarding whether the invoice is paid, pending, or overdue.

Challenges and Considerations
Despite the potential benefits, there are challenges related to tokenized invoices. These include regulatory compliance, the integration of existing systems with blockchain technology, and ensuring user education regarding new processes. Moreover, diversity in blockchain standards can complicate interoperability between systems.

Clear example on the topic: Tokenized Invoice
Imagine a startup that offers freelance design services. When a client commissions a project, the startup generates an invoice for $2,000 due in 30 days. Instead of sending a traditional invoice, the startup uses a tokenized invoice system. The $2,000 invoice is converted into a unique token stored on the blockchain, equipped with all necessary details like the due date and the clientβs information. Once the client reviews and accepts the design, they can pay the invoice easily using cryptocurrency, and the payment is automatically recognized by the token thanks to the smart contract embedded within the invoice metadata. This streamlined process not only saves time but also reduces the chances of disputes. The startup gains immediate clarity and assurance regarding its payment, while the client enjoys a secured transaction.
